What It Does

Modulation 2 applies a physical modulation and demodulation algorithm to video, simulating how brightness information travels through analog radio signals. Higher brightness areas produce higher frequencies, lower brightness produces lower frequencies. The result is a distinctive analog distortion look, ranging from subtle wave-based color shifting to heavy glitch-style effects depending on how you push the parameters.

Originally an After Effects plugin, Premiere Pro support was added in version 2.1.0 (August 2025).

Key Features

Five color modes. Greyscale, RGB, CMY, CMYK, and HSV give you distinct ways to work with color channels. CMY and CMYK look similar but behave differently: in CMY mode the Key color appears at the intersection of the three channels, while in CMYK the Key channel is modulated independently.

Omega, Phase, and Distortion controls. These three parameters drive the wave animation. Omega scales the waves, Phase controls how much waves react to color values, and Distortion sets the number of waves. Animating these three together creates the characteristic moving, shifting look.

Lowpass filters. Three checkbox-based lowpass filters plus one adjustable lowpass filter are available. At very low values on the fourth filter (around 0.0040 or lower), combined with Distortion set to 1000, the effect produces an unusual blurry quality that behaves differently from a standard blur.

Switchable channels. Individual color channels can be toggled on and off, giving you fine control over which parts of the image the effect touches.

Direction and orientation. Waves can run forward or backward, and can be oriented vertically or horizontally.

Who It’s For

Modulation 2 suits editors and motion designers working on music videos, title sequences, or any project that calls for analog-era distortion aesthetics. The color mode options make it flexible enough for both monochrome and full-color treatments. Because Premiere Pro support was added recently, it works natively in the timeline without a round-trip to After Effects.

Pricing

Modulation 2 is a one-time purchase at $39.99. A free trial is available from aescripts. Upgrades from Modulation 1 are free for purchases made after April 1, 2024; otherwise the upgrade costs $10, applied automatically at checkout when you log in.

Modulation 2 is also available as part of the Zaebects Bundle (with Signal and Physarum) at $99.99, saving 23% compared to buying separately.
